NICHOLS GREEN PHASE IV
NICHOLS GREEN PHASE IV is a new construction project at BEAUMONT STREET, Jacksonville, in Cherokee County, TX, tracked from its Texas Department of Licensing and Regulation (TDLR) registration. Construction complete (TDLR inspection passed Dec 2016). The project has an estimated value of $352K.

NICHOLS GREEN PHASE IV is a New Construction project located at BEAUMONT STREET, Jacksonville, TX 75766 in Jacksonville, Texas. The project has an estimated value of $352K. CITY OF JACKSONVILLE is the property owner and MHS PLANNING & DESIGN LLC is the design firm of record. The project was registered with TDLR on March 2, 2016.

Note: This project is registered under the Texas Accessibility Standards (TAS) program. TDLR registration is required for commercial and public facility construction to ensure compliance with accessibility requirements under Texas Government Code Chapter 469.
